AI语音SDK在语音助手中的应用有哪些?

随着科技的飞速发展,人工智能(AI)已经深入到我们生活的方方面面。其中,AI语音技术作为人工智能的一个重要分支,正在逐渐改变着我们的生活方式。AI语音SDK作为一种开发工具,为开发者提供了便捷的语音交互功能。本文将详细介绍AI语音SDK在语音助手中的应用,以及一个关于AI语音SDK的故事。

一、AI语音SDK概述

AI语音SDK(Software Development Kit)是指一套用于开发语音交互功能的软件开发工具包。它包括语音识别、语音合成、语音识别语义理解等功能模块,可以帮助开发者快速搭建语音助手、智能客服、智能家居等应用。

二、AI语音SDK在语音助手中的应用

1.语音识别

语音识别是语音助手的核心功能之一,通过AI语音SDK可以实现语音到文字的转换。用户可以通过语音指令控制语音助手完成各种任务,如查询天气、播放音乐、设定闹钟等。语音识别技术的精准度和速度直接影响着用户体验。

2.语音合成

语音合成是将文字转换为语音的技术,是语音助手输出语音内容的基础。AI语音SDK提供的语音合成功能,可以实现自然流畅的语音输出,让用户感受到更加真实的交互体验。

3.语音识别语义理解

语音识别语义理解是AI语音SDK的高级功能,它能够解析用户语音中的语义,理解用户意图,从而实现更加智能的交互。例如,当用户说“我想听一首周杰伦的歌曲”,语音助手可以通过语义理解功能,找到周杰伦的歌曲并播放。

4.语音识别与语音合成的结合

AI语音SDK将语音识别与语音合成相结合,实现了语音助手的人机交互。用户可以通过语音指令控制语音助手,语音助手则通过语音合成输出回复,形成完整的语音交互流程。

5.多语言支持

AI语音SDK支持多种语言,方便开发者根据用户需求定制语音助手。例如,对于面向国际市场的产品,可以通过AI语音SDK实现多语言语音交互功能。

6.离线识别

离线识别功能是指语音助手在无网络环境下也能实现语音识别。这对于一些对网络环境要求较高的场景(如车载语音助手、智能家居等)具有重要意义。

三、AI语音SDK的故事

故事的主人公是一位年轻的程序员小张,他热衷于人工智能领域的研究。在一次偶然的机会,小张接触到了AI语音SDK,并被其强大的功能所吸引。于是,他决定利用AI语音SDK开发一款语音助手,为用户提供便捷的语音交互体验。

小张从语音识别模块入手,通过AI语音SDK实现了语音到文字的转换。随后,他又添加了语音合成功能,让语音助手能够输出自然流畅的语音回复。在开发过程中,小张不断优化语音识别语义理解功能,使得语音助手能够更好地理解用户意图。

经过几个月的努力,小张终于完成了语音助手的开发。他将这款语音助手命名为“小智”,并上线公测。用户们纷纷为“小智”的智能程度和便捷性点赞。随着口碑的传播,“小智”逐渐成为了一款备受欢迎的语音助手。

这个故事告诉我们,AI语音SDK在语音助手中的应用具有广阔的前景。通过不断优化和拓展功能,AI语音SDK将为开发者提供更加便捷的开发体验,为用户带来更加智能的语音交互服务。

总结

AI语音SDK作为一种开发工具,在语音助手中的应用日益广泛。通过语音识别、语音合成、语音识别语义理解等功能模块,AI语音SDK可以帮助开发者快速搭建智能语音助手、智能客服、智能家居等应用。随着技术的不断进步,AI语音SDK将在更多领域发挥重要作用,为我们的生活带来更多便利。

猜你喜欢:智能语音助手